编程语言的前端后端是什么意思
-
编程语言的前端和后端是指在开发Web应用程序时涉及的两个不同的方面。
前端指的是用户直接与之交互的部分,也就是显示在浏览器中的界面。前端开发主要涉及到HTML、CSS和JavaScript等技术,用于构建网页的结构、样式和交互。前端开发人员负责将设计师提供的UI设计转化为可交互的用户界面,使用户能够直观地与网页进行交互。
后端指的是处理前端请求和逻辑的部分,也称为服务器端。后端开发主要涉及到数据库、服务器和编程语言等技术,用于处理用户请求、查询数据库、进行业务逻辑处理等。后端开发人员负责编写服务器端代码,与数据库进行交互,并提供数据和功能给前端。
前端和后端是紧密相连的,通过前端和后端的协作,实现了用户与网站之间的交互和数据传输。前端和后端的开发是分工合作的,前端负责用户界面的展示和交互,后端负责处理数据和逻辑。两者共同协作,构建出完整的Web应用程序。
1年前 -
编程语言的前端和后端是指在Web开发中的不同方面。前端指的是与用户直接交互的部分,即用户在浏览器中看到和操作的界面。后端指的是服务器端的部分,即处理数据和逻辑的部分。
-
前端:前端开发主要关注于用户界面的设计和交互。前端开发人员使用HTML、CSS和JavaScript等技术来创建网页,并确保网页在不同浏览器上的兼容性。他们负责处理用户的输入和操作,并将数据发送给后端进行处理。前端开发人员还可以使用一些前端框架和库来简化开发过程,如React、Vue.js和Angular等。
-
后端:后端开发主要关注于服务器端的处理和逻辑。后端开发人员使用不同的编程语言和框架来处理数据的存储和处理,以及与数据库的交互。他们负责处理前端发送的请求,并根据业务逻辑进行相应的处理和计算。后端开发人员还负责确保服务器的安全性和性能,并处理大量的并发请求。
-
数据交互:前端和后端之间通过网络进行数据交互。前端发送请求到后端,后端处理请求并返回相应的数据给前端。这个过程通常使用HTTP协议来进行通信。前端和后端之间的数据交互可以是同步的,也可以是异步的。异步交互通常使用AJAX技术来实现,可以在不刷新整个页面的情况下更新部分数据。
-
技术栈:前端和后端开发人员需要掌握不同的技术栈。前端开发人员需要熟悉HTML、CSS和JavaScript等技术,以及一些前端框架和库。后端开发人员需要掌握一种或多种后端编程语言,如Java、Python、PHP或Node.js等,以及一些后端框架和数据库技术。
-
协作:前端和后端开发人员通常需要紧密合作,共同完成一个Web应用的开发。前端开发人员负责实现用户界面和交互,后端开发人员负责处理数据和逻辑。他们需要协商接口规范,确保数据的正确传递和处理。在一些大型团队中,还可能有专门负责前端和后端协调工作的全栈开发人员。
总之,前端和后端是Web开发中两个重要的方面,分别负责用户界面和交互,以及数据处理和逻辑。前端和后端开发人员需要掌握不同的技术和工具,通过数据交互和协作来共同完成一个Web应用的开发。
1年前 -
-
在编程领域中,前端和后端是指两个不同的方面或层面,涉及到网站或应用程序的开发和运行。
前端是指用户直接与之交互的部分,也称为客户端。它通常包括用户界面、用户体验和交互逻辑。前端开发主要使用HTML、CSS和JavaScript等技术来实现网页的布局、样式和交互效果。前端开发人员负责将设计师提供的视觉设计转化为可视化的网页或应用程序界面,并确保用户可以方便地使用和浏览网站。此外,前端开发人员还需要关注网站的性能和响应速度,以确保用户体验良好。
后端是指网站或应用程序背后的逻辑和数据处理部分,也称为服务器端。后端开发主要涉及处理数据、逻辑和算法等方面。后端开发人员使用编程语言(如Java、Python、PHP等)和数据库(如MySQL、Oracle等)来实现服务器端的功能。他们负责处理用户提交的数据、与数据库进行交互、执行业务逻辑和生成动态内容。后端开发人员还负责确保服务器的安全性、性能和可扩展性。
前端和后端之间通过网络进行通信。用户在前端输入数据或与网站进行交互时,前端将这些请求发送到后端,后端处理请求并返回响应给前端。这种前后端的交互使得网站或应用程序能够提供更复杂、更强大的功能。
总结起来,前端和后端是网站或应用程序开发中的两个不可或缺的方面。前端负责用户界面和交互逻辑,后端负责处理数据和业务逻辑。两者共同协作,共同构建出完整的网站或应用程序。
1年前